  • Why does Field ask for a contribution in addition to tuition?

    Tuition alone does not fully cover the cost of a Field education. Charitable donations beyond tuition support key programs that make Field an exceptional school and make a Field education accessible to any academically qualified student, regardless of their ability to pay tuition. In 2021-2022, the difference between tuition and the full cost of education per student was $3,322. Philanthropy bridges and provides an opportunity for all families to give at a level that is comfortable and meaningful to them. Philanthropy also supports the multitude of student experiences available at Field including Intersession, athletics, and performing arts. 
  • Why not raise tuition to cover operating expenses?

    We strive to keep tuition increases minimal so that our tuition remains competitive. We want to maintain socioeconomic diversity in our student body and seek additional revenues through charitable contributions to maintain a reasonable tuition structure. A diverse student body is integral to and enriches the Field educational experience.

  • APPRECIATED STOCK

    Learn more about Field's stock giving information. By giving appreciated stock directly to Field, you can save the capital gains tax and can claim a deduction on your income tax. Contact Director of Advancement Susan Vogel with questions or to arrange a transfer.
  • IRA DISTRIBUTION

    Save time and taxes! If you're required to take a minimum annual distribution from an IRA, you may be able to avoid the associated taxes by requesting that payment be sent directly to Field as a charitable gift. Contact Director of Advancement Susan Vogel to learn more.
